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Welda, is another warm month, with temperature in the range of an average high of 85.1°F (29.5°C) and an average low of 66.4°F (19.1°C).

Temperature

The arrival of August sees a recorded average high-temperature of a moderately hot 85.1°F (29.5°C), showing little divergence from the previous month's conditions. August's nights in Welda observe an average temperature of 66.4°F (19.1°C).

Heat index

The heat index value during August is computed to be a very hot 95°F (35°C). Apply extra caution, heat cramps and heat exhaustion could happen. Heatstroke might occur with long-duration activity.
In reference to the heat index, it's for places in shade and with a slight wind. Direct exposure to sunshine could lead to a heat index increase by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'felt air temperature', provides an understanding of perceived warmth by combining temperature and relative humidity. The individual's experience of temperature can be shaped by numerous aspects such as metabolic variations, physical exertion, and attire. Direct sun rays can make one feel hotter, potentially raising the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are largely significant for babies and toddlers. Young ones are generally more prone to risk than adults due to their reduced ability to sweat. Their large skin surface area relative to their diminutive bodies and elevated heat production from their activities further enhance this risk.
By perspiring, the human body can shed its excessive warmth since evaporated sweat cools it off. Under high air temperature and high humidity (high heat index) conditions, the body's ability to perspire is compromised, increasing the sensation of heat. Rising body temperatures due to excess heat retention could signify impending heat disorders.

Humidity

In Welda, the average relative humidity in August is 75%.

Rainfall

In Welda, during August, the rain falls for 11.1 days and regularly aggregates up to 1.38" (35mm) of precipitation. In Welda, during the entire year, the rain falls for 102.5 days and collects up to 12.44" (316m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

April, June through September are months without snowfall.

Daylight

In August, the average length of the day is 13h and 36min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:24 am and sunset at 8:30 pm. On the last day of August, sunrise is at 6:50 am and sunset at 7:51 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in August in Welda is 10.2h.

UV index

In August, the average daily maximum UV index in Welda, Kansas, is 6.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the average person.
Note: The maximum UV index, 6 during August, leads to the following recommendations:
Dodge overexposure. Fair-skinned people can get singed in less than 20 minutes. Remember that the sun's UV radiation is strongest between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Make an effort to avoid direct sun exposure during these hours. For minimizing sun-related eye damage, always choose sunglasses with UVA and UVB coverage.
